One Big Thing

Half way through our tea and crumpets, Mick and I were approached by a lady asking if we had cycled more than 5K today. I think the lycra shorts and fluorescent tops were a give away of our hobby. As we had, we qualified for a free T shirt each. What a bargain. It is all about the BUCS (British Universities and Colleges Sport) launching an initiative calling on universities to promote physical activities for the student population.  They had a stand outside the cafe so we completed a card outlining what we had done and Zoe presented us with our gifts. The Old Nick

This building, in Albion Street Kenilworth, was the old Police Station, now the British Legion Club. I went there in 1967 to find out about joining the Police and it closed shortly afterwards. Not because of my visit I hasten to add!
